Игровой аппарат на ардуино

Игровой аппарат на ардуино

Игровой на ардуино аппарат


🎁 CCЫЛКА НА САЙТ >>


🎰 СКАЧАТЬ НА ТЕЛЕФОН >>


Ардуино игровой на аппарат


Если вы хотите не только теоретически изучить основы использования популярной микроконтроллерной платформы Arduino для разработки электронных проектов, но и получить первичные практические навыки, то этот комплект для вас.В него входит популярная книга Дж. Блума “Изучаем Arduino: инструменты и методы технического волшебства”, плата Arduino Uno с кабелем для подключения к ПК, макетная плата, электронные компоненты и брошюра с упражнениями.


С помощью набора, вы сможете выполнить 25 экспериментов и создать рабочие проекты, описанные на страницах книги, а также более 30 примеров, которые интегрированы в среду разработки Arduino IDE и описаны на сайте разработчика Arduino.


Ардуино аппарат игровой на


Плата с контроллером x1 Плата, совместимая с Arduino Uno R3 x1 Кабель USB


Макетная плата, провода x1 Плата макетная беспаечная [400 контактов], 8,5х5,5 см x10 Провода с разъемами “папа-папа” x1 Набор проводов 65 шт. с разъемами «папа-папа»


Аппарат игровой ардуино на


Резисторы, потенциометры x10 Резистор 10 кОм x10 Резистор 220 Ом x1 Потенциометр 10 кОм


Светодиоды x2 Светодиод красный 5 мм x2 Светодиод зеленый 5 мм x2 Светодиод синий 5 мм x2 Светодиод желтый 5 мм x1 Светодиод RGB


Игровой ардуино на аппарат


Микросхема x1 Микросхема 8-разрядного сдвигового регистра 74HC595


Датчики x1 Фоторезистор GL5539 x1 Аналоговый датчик температуры TMP36


Аппарат игровой ардуино на


Звуковые устройства x1 Динамик с сопротивлением катушки 8 Ом x1 Пьезоэлектрический зуммер 5 В


Питание x1 Батарея напряжением 9 В x1 Разъем для батареи напряжением 9 В


Ардуино игровой аппарат на


Инструменты, вспомогательные устройства x1 Монтажная диэлектрическая площадка для Arduino x1 Отвертка


Книга x1 Руководство пользователя x1 Блум Дж. “Изучаем Arduino: инструменты и методы технического волшебства (2 изд.)” – СПб.: БХВ-Петербург, 2020. – 544 с.


На аппарат ардуино игровой


Адрес:Нижегородская областьНижний Новгородул. Варварская 32, офис 420 (4 этаж)


Ардуино — это маленький компьютер, который умеет почти всё то же, что и его большие братья: ноутбуки, смартфоны и персональные компьютеры. Но, в отличие от них, Ардуино имеет весьма ограниченную вычислительную мощность и очень мало памяти. Его удел — простые расчеты, сбор данных с датчиков и управление исполнительными механизмами.


Игровой на аппарат ардуино


Разумеется, на Ардуино невозможно сделать практически ни одну современную игру. Но когда-то, на заре вычислительной техники, игры были настолько простыми, что вполне могли уместиться в нескольких килобайтах памяти и сносно работали даже на процессорах с частотой 1.19 МГц (Atari 2600).


Несмотря на примитивную графику, ретро игры были ничуть не менее увлекательными, чем их современные последователи.


Игровой аппарат на ардуино


В течение трёх уроков мы будем делать упрощенный аналог известной в далекие 1970-е игры Space Invaders. Суть игры — летать на космическом корабле, уворачиваться от выстрелов инопланетян и сбивать их корабли ответным огнем.


Если вам не хватает что-то из этого, можно добавить эти компоненты в корзину прямо здесь и затем оформить заказ в нашем интернет-магазине.


Аппарат игровой ардуино на


На этом и последующих уроках мы соберем сам игровой автомат на основе самой обычной Ардуино Уно и напишем для него программу. Вперед!


Ваш адрес email не будет опубликован. Обязательные поля помечены *


Ардуино на аппарат игровой


Сегодня наблюдается рост интереса пользователей к внедрению в домах и квартирах если не полноценных систем «умного дома», то некоторых элементов Home Automation (домашней автоматизации).


В связи с этим производители ведут разработки и наращивают выпуск систем различной сложности – от полноценных коробочных решений с использованием ИИ, до комплектов на базе микроконтроллеров, позволяющих быстро решать прикладные задачи различной сложности.


Игровой на аппарат ардуино


Некоторые из них помогут как сделать первые шаги в разработке, так и реализовать достаточно сложные проекты. Например¸ вполне реальный вариант – умный дом на Arduino своими руками.


Arduino – это полностью открытая программно-аппаратная платформа для создания систем роботизации и автоматизации (в том числе, домашней) различной сложности. Ее основное отличие – простота в использовании, возможность освоения и создания вполне работоспособных проектов даже без глубоких знаний электроники и программирования.


Аппарат на ардуино игровой


Аппаратные средства Arduino позволяют получить сигналы от сенсоров (например, уровень температуры, наличие света, нажатие на кнопку) или более сложных систем, таких как html-страницы.


Программный код обрабатывает их и выдает сигналы на исполнительные механизмы, например, включает сервопривод, замыкает контакты реле или сервисы, способные выполнять весьма сложные операции – от отправки сообщений на e-mail до размещения контента на страницах.


Аппарат игровой ардуино на


Создание умного дома на Arduino своими руками мало чем отличается от разработки и реализации любой другой электронной системы. Процесс включает несколько обязательных этапов.


Задание для проекта должно быть определено максимально точно и подробно. Например, решается одна из частных home automation – включить освещение крыльца, когда в темное время к нему приближается человек. Это общее описание задачи нуждается в более конкретных формулировках для проектирования.


Игровой аппарат ардуино на


На этом этапе определяется набор сенсоров для получения данных (триггеров и условий) и исполнительных механизмов для выполнения действий.


Даже в простейшем рассматриваемом случае возможны несколько вариантов реализации. Например, определять присутствие человека у крыльца можно:


Ардуино игровой аппарат на


Аналогичным образом рассматриваются ситуации с определением уровня освещенности и включением света на крыльце.


Завершает этап запись алгоритма с учетом принятых решений, например:


Игровой ардуино аппарат на


Еще один результат этого этапа – перечень необходимого оборудования и материалов. Для сборки системы потребуются:


После составления структурной схемы проекта можно приступать к разработке принципиальной, которая, прежде всего, включает выбор оборудования.


Аппарат на ардуино игровой


Поскольку базовая платформа – Arduino, определена ранее, остается выбрать конкретную модель контроллера и, при необходимости, расширение. Задача не сложная, поскольку ассортимент устройств достаточно обширен и включает модели для большинства практических задач.


Кроме стандартных контроллеров разработаны и поставляются специализированные, с дополнительными интерфейсами на борту:


Ардуино аппарат на игровой


Кроме того, для работы с различными стандартами связи и устройствами можно использовать стандартные платы расширения:


При необходимости можно найти и другие конфигурации полностью совместимых контроллеров, выпускаемые сторонними разработчиками. Полный список одобренного оборудования размещен на странице playground.arduino.cc/Main/SimilarBoards/ официального сайта.


На ардуино аппарат игровой


При выборе датчиков и исполнительных механизмов нет значительных ограничений. Единственное требование – обеспечить совместимость с портами Arduino по уровням сигналов и нагрузке.


Однако, при желании, и это требование легко обходится за счет сборки собственных или использования готовых плат согласования.


На аппарат игровой ардуино


После покупки контроллера и периферийных устройств следует начертить принципиальную схему системы автоматизации. С платами Arduino это труда не составит, главная задача разработчика – выбрать пины портов ввода/вывода для подключения – это важная информация для написания программы.


Когда принципиальная схема готова, начинается важнейший этап проектирования – написание программы для контроллера. Для этого необходимо скачать среду разработки Arduino IDE.


На ардуино игровой аппарат


Программное обеспечение скачивают со страницы официального сайта www.arduino.cc/en/software.


Для работы под Windows можно скачать установщик или ZIP-архив софта. Использовать установщик для неопытных пользователей предпочтительнее – установка драйверов будет произведена автоматически вместе с установкой программы.


Аппарат ардуино игровой на


При использовании ZIP-архива достаточно развернуть программу на жестком диске ПК и запустить IDE. В этом случае программа также попытается установить драйвера, но, возможно, придется обновить их вручную в Панели управления. Все необходимые .inf файлы входят в комплект поставки.


Для этого достаточно выполнить входящий в комплект поставки простейший скетч с управлением светоиодом.


Аппарат игровой на ардуино


После проверки можно приступать к разработке собственной программы.


Программирование скетча можно выполнить непосредственно в редакторе среды разработки или в любом другом удобном текстовом редакторе (в последнем случае не забыть сохранить работу в файле .ino). Встроенный язык программирования Arduino является клоном языка C++ с некоторыми упрощениями и дополнительными функциями и библиотеками для обращения к функционалу контроллера.


Игровой ардуино аппарат на


В остальном полностью поддерживается стандарт языка, включая директивы компилятора, константы и типы данных, операторы (в т.ч. унарные), функции.


Со всеми платами контролеров и расширений поставляются необходимые библиотеки для работы со всем аппаратным обеспечением. Кроме того, в сети доступны тысячи готовых библиотек разработанных сообществом. Подобрать нужную (с документацией) можно по ссылкам на официальном сайте playground.arduino.cc/Main/LibraryList/ и www.arduinolibraries.info/ или на GitHub.


На ардуино аппарат игровой


Соответственно, для реализации поставленной задачи разработчику нужно:


Работать с Arduino можно и без установки IDE. Для этого удобно использовать:


Игровой ардуино аппарат на


Для пользователей, далеких от программирования на любых языках, созданы альтернативные варианты разработки проектов – визуальные. Среди наиболее известных:


Таким образом, умный дом на Arduino своими руками – решение, доступное практически каждому. Ассортимент аппаратных средств позволяет решать задачи от простейших до максимально сложных (в том числе, за счет взаимодействия нескольких контролеров).


На аппарат ардуино игровой


Способствует этому и накопленный сообществом богатый опыт, и полная открытость проекта, благодаря которой можно найти готовые программные разработки для большинства процессов home automation.


Современные умные устройства предназначены для облегчения жизни людей. Умный счетчик электроэнергии позволяет автоматически снимать и передавать их дистанционно, благодаря чему […]


Игровой на ардуино аппарат


Камера видеонаблюдения за животными – это компактное устройство с возможностью визуального контроля, которое можно использовать для фиксации деятельности домашних питомцев. […]


Полная открытость, всё-так немного настораживает. Если одному программисту или электронику легко собрать модуль, то другой легко его и вскроет.


На аппарат ардуино игровой


Имея навыки компьютерщика и необходимое оборудование, не составит труда самостоятельно смонтировать это и настроить.


Показала своему парню эту статью, он у меня отлично разбирается в программировании. Сказал, ничего сложного здесь нет.


На аппарат игровой ардуино


Не представляю себя с паяльником, собирающая электронную схему. Наверное, это не моё. Но дом умный безумно нравится.


Обзоры новинок, сравнения и рейтинги, советы по выбору и эксплуатации


Игровой ардуино аппарат на


Усилитель Wi-Fi – это сетевое устройство, предназначенное для приема сигнала от маршрутизатора с последующим увеличением мощности при передаче. Главное достоинство […]


Кофемашина – автоматизированный бытовой прибор, предназначенный для варки кофе и прочих тонизирующих напитков. Также в конструкции рассматриваемых приборов могут присутствовать […]


Ардуино игровой аппарат на


Смарт-кольцо – это компактное электронное устройство с формой классического кольца, дополненное привычными функциями смартфона или планшета. В большинстве случаев подобные […]


Умный утюг – это бытовой прибор для разглаживания одежды, отличающийся от классических моделей поддержкой системы дистанционного управления. Как правило, такие […]

Report Page